Shakespeare's Tragic Ambitions

This chapter examines the intricate dynamics of Shakespeare's works, particularly focusing on the endings of 'King Lear' and their impact on the audience's interpretation of tragedy. The discussion reveals how minor changes in text can significantly shift thematic weight, highlighting the tension between ambition and moral integrity. Additionally, the chapter delves into the psychological conflicts of characters, illustrating the complex interplay of courage, guilt, and the consequences of their desires.
